H07ZZ-F vs. H07RN-F LS0H – Which One Should You Choose?

H07ZZ-F and H07RN-F LS0H cables are designed for different applications and technical requirements. They differ in material composition, flexibility, mechanical resistance, and fire safety properties. Below is a detailed comparison:



1. Insulation and Outer Sheath Material
  • H07ZZ-F: Made of halogen-free, flame-retardant (LSZH) compounds. Does not release toxic gases in case of fire.
  • H07RN-F LS0H: Rubber-based outer sheath with LS0H (Low Smoke Zero Halogen) properties. Offers high flexibility.



2. Mechanical Strength
  • H07ZZ-F: Medium mechanical strength, lower flexibility.
  • H07RN-F LS0H: High mechanical strength, resistant to oil, impact, and abrasion.



3. Flexibility
  • H07ZZ-F: Medium flexibility, not designed for continuous bending and stretching.
  • H07RN-F LS0H: Extremely flexible due to its rubber sheath, ideal for dynamic and mobile applications.




4. Fire Safety and Halogen Content
  • H07ZZ-F: Halogen-free (LSZH – Low Smoke Zero Halogen). Does not emit toxic gases in case of fire.
  • H07RN-F LS0H: Also LS0H but behaves differently due to its rubber-based composition.





5. Application Areas
  • H07ZZ-F: Used in indoor environments, commercial buildings, hospitals, and areas where fire safety is critical.
  • H07RN-F LS0H: Suitable for outdoor use, industrial environments, stage/event wiring, and harsh conditions.





6. Chemical and Environmental Resistance
  • H07ZZ-F: Moderate resistance to chemicals and environmental factors. Sensitive to oil and water.
  • H07RN-F LS0H: Highly resistant to oil, UV rays, water, and chemicals.




7. Cost and Pricing
  • H07ZZ-F: More expensive, especially for fixed installations.
  • H07RN-F LS0H:More cost-effective and offers greater durability and flexibility.




Final Comparison & Selection Guide




FeatureH07ZZ-FH07RN-F LS0H
InsulationEI8  70°C  RubberEI4  60°C  Rubber
JacketEM8 70°CEM2 60°C
Mechanical StrengthMediumHigh
FlexibilityLow to MediumHigh
Fire SafetyVery HighHigh
Application AreasIndoor, fixed installationsOutdoor, industrial, portable use
Chemical ResistanceModerateHigh
Water & Oil ResistanceLimitedExcellent
UV ResistanceLimited (High if required)Limited (High if required)
CostHigherMedium

Selection Recommendations:

-For indoor environments where fire safety is a priority: H07ZZ-F is recommended. 
-For outdoor, industrial, or mobile applications:H07RN-F LS0H is the better choice.
